Position Purpose and Objectives

 

As a Business Banking Specialist at Credit Union of Texas (CUTX), you will professionally represent the Credit Union in the community for the purpose of generating additional business opportunities, as well as assisting in building and further extending the CUTX commercial services brand, with adherence to our mission of providing exceptional experiences and frictionless financial services to its members. 

 

This position is responsible for acquiring and developing commercial and business banking relationships and deliver a full range of business deposits and related products/services such as treasury management, business credit cards and payment solutions. Additional responsibilities include helping facilitate credit requests for small-to-moderate sized business members.

 

The role primarily engages in outbound calling activities to generate new business opportunities within CUTX’s designated and targeted market areas, as well as serve as a subject matter expert and partner with branch personnel and the commercial lending team, to provide continued education and expertise around business deposits and related cash management services.
